The most overlooked diagnostic tool is a conversation. A careful mechanic starts by asking the ideal questions: when did the sign start, what changed recently, how does it act cold versus warm, and what lights or messages appeared on the dash. The goal is to narrow the field of most likely causes before touching the automobile. A no-start after a long highway run points in a various instructions than a no-start after a week of sitting. An intermittent stall when turning might link a loose battery terminal or a harness routed too tight.
Context matters. Fuel level, recent refueling, weather condition, and any current work all seed a mental tree of possibilities. A battery replaced 3 days ago on a cars and truck that now cranks gradually recommends a poor ground connection or a loose positive clamp before a generator failure. A misfire that vanishes above 2,000 rpm sounds various than a rough idle that gets worse with the air conditioner on. The notes from this initial interview guide what the mechanic grabs from the van first.
Before plugging in a scanner, a mobile mechanic scans the bay. A loose consumption boot, a cracked vacuum hose, an oil leakage misting a serpentine belt, a green crust on battery posts, an aftermarket alarm spliced into the ignition circuit, or coolant residue on a heating unit hose all plant flags. Modern vehicles conceal a lot, yet you can still identify damaged clips on a mass air flow sensing unit, chafed electrical wiring along the radiator assistance, or a missing undertray letting water spray into connectors.
Small ideas add up. The smell of raw fuel near the rail indicate a leak or a stopped working injector seal. A sweet smell and white residue around a water pump weep hole suggests a bearing on its method out. If the MIL is flashing at idle and the exhaust gives off sulfur, the catalytic converter is in risk. Each observation tunes the next step so you squander no time.
A mobile mechanic must cover 80 percent of diagnostic scenarios with 20 percent of the shop stock. The package fits in drawers and cases that can be rolled to the vehicle. It is not minimalist, just intentional.
Core electronics: A bi-directional scan tool that checks out manufacturer-specific data, performs active tests, and resets adaptations, plus a backup dongle with a robust smart device app. A mid-level two-channel oscilloscope covers crank and cam signals, injector and coil patterns, and network lines. A quality digital multimeter with a low-amps clamp is non-negotiable.
Mechanical basics: Torque wrenches, a full socket and bit set including E-torx and inverted Torx, long-reach pliers, and versatile extension shafts. A compact jack with stands for safe lifting on level surface areas and chocks to protect wheels.
Specialty testers: A smoke device for intake and EVAP leakages, a fuel pressure gauge with adapter fittings, a cooling system pressure tester, a vacuum gauge, and a combustion leakage tester. For hybrids, an effectively rated feline III/IV multimeter, insulated gloves, and service disconnect tools.
Support gear: Work lights, a folding mat, spill containment pads, a battery post cleaner, and a dive pack that can handle 1,000 to 2,000 peak amps without drama. Weather defense, like a little canopy, helps when operating in drizzle or sun.
This equipment is selected for dependability and footprint. You can not save every puller, but you can bring a universal center puller and thread repair work package that conserve a task twice a month.
Modern lorries report more than fault codes. The mobile mechanic's scan tool is a window into live information, freeze frames, and network health.
Freeze frame records the conditions when a code set. Expect you see P0302 with engine load at 12 percent, RPM at 750, coolant at 191 F, and intake air temp matching ambient. Misfire at idle with typical temp and low load. The next step is to take a look at Mode 6 misfire counters across all cylinders. If cylinders 2 and 5 program counts, examine a shared coil driver or a typical consumption leak. If just cylinder 2 spikes and fuel trims are positive at idle and regular above 2,000 rpm, a vacuum leakage near cylinder 2 is likely.
Fuel trims tell you where to look. Short-term trims reacting rapidly and long-term trims elevated on one bank at idle, then normal under load, suggest unmetered air. Elevated trims at all loads indicate low fuel pressure or a MAF underreporting. If trims go negative, perhaps a leaking injector is enhancing the mix or the fuel pressure regulator is stuck.
A good mobile mechanic compares scan data versus anticipated baselines. MAF readings at idle roughly equivalent 1 gram per second per liter of engine displacement. A 2.5 liter engine need to hover around 2.5 to 3.5 g/s at idle, increasing efficiently with RPM. Throttle position on an electronic throttle body at idle relaxes 7 to 12 percent. ECT sensors should track up from ambient to thermostat opening range, typically 180 to 205 F, without erratic jumps. These quick peace of mind checks catch a bad sensing unit that looks plausible up until you do the math.
On-site diagnostics follows a pattern that starts large and narrows. It keeps you from chasing a ghost when a basic condition is missing.
Verify the grievance. Replicate the symptom while keeping an eye on pertinent criteria. If the complaint is a no-start, compare no-crank and crank-no-start.
Confirm the fundamentals. Battery voltage under load, charging voltage, main grounds, and power circulation to vital modules. Many "secret" problems trace back to a compromised ground strap or a rusty underhood fuse link.
Divide the system. For a crank-no-start, figure out spark, fuel, and compression. Pull a coil and utilize a stimulate tester, check fuel pressure at the rail, and perform a fast relative compression test with a current clamp on the battery cable while cranking. On lots of four-cylinder engines, you anticipate relatively even current humps; a flat drop points to a weak cylinder.
Use targeted tests. As soon as the system at fault is separated, probe much deeper with a scope or smoke. For a thought vacuum leak, introduce smoke at the intake and search for wisps around the consumption manifold gasket, PCV lines, and brake booster hose.
This flow keeps the van organized and the client notified. You prevent switching parts on a hunch, which generally costs more time in the long run.
Electrical issues drive a big share of mobile calls. The vehicle starts, then passes away when put in equipment. The radio resets on bumps. The ABS light appears after heavy rain. Before blaming modules, a mechanic checks power and ground integrity.
Voltage drop screening is the most sincere method to do it. For instance, put the meter across the favorable battery terminal and the starter terminal while cranking. Anything more than about 0.5 volts on the favorable side suggests a high-resistance course. Repeat on the ground side in between the starter case and the negative battery terminal. You can evaluate generator output under load with lights and blower on. A charging system that sits at 13.2 volts with accessories on might be healthy on some vehicles or minimal on others; seek advice from known-good information, but a lot of late models choose 13.6 to 14.6 volts stabilized.
Ground straps rust where they bolt to the body. On lorries that live near the coast or in snow states, I have seen ground eyelets collapse like toast. A five-minute tidy, crimp, and resecure task can turn a "no communication with PCM" into a clean start.

A low-pressure port test can conserve hours. If spec calls for 58 psi on a returnless system and you determine 42 to 45 psi that sags throughout crank, you likely have a weak pump or restricted filter. Numerous vehicles bury the filter in the tank, so you document the pressure and pattern. If pressure is solid but trims stay favorable throughout loads, a lazy MAF or a small intake leakage is more likely.
Spark should be validated under load. A coil that arcs to ground when managed the plug might look ok, but under compression it stops working. A spark tester with an adjustable space provides a much better read. On direct-injection engines, fouled plugs from short journeys prevail, especially in winter. Removing plugs on the roadside is not glamorous, however a quick evaluation typically reveals oil contamination from a valve cover leak that shorted the coil boot. If I see a coil soaked in oil, I keep in mind that any brand-new coil will die early unless the valve cover gasket is fixed.
Air delivery consists of mechanical stability. A torn consumption boot after the MAF sensing unit will lean out the mix and spike trims at idle. If the boot collapses under velocity, the car feels gutless. Smoke validates what eyes in some cases miss out on, specifically in confined transverse bays.
Late-model cars are rolling networks. A mobile mechanic needs to be comfortable diagnosing CAN bus concerns in the field. The scan tool's network test can quickly identify modules that stop working to interact. If the powertrain control module exists but the ABS is not, go to the ABS module connector with a scope. A healthy high-speed CAN set sits around 2.5 volts bias with differential swings to about 3.5 on CAN High and 1.5 on CAN Low during traffic. A flat line on one leg points to a brief or an open in the twisted pair.
Power and ground at the quiet module still precede. If present, isolate areas by unplugging branches if the harness architecture allows. In some cases a water leak into a footwell wears away a port and drags the bus down. On a crossover I saw last spring, a top-mounted rear wiper motor shorted its LIN bus and propagated faults across the network. Pulling the rear hatch trim and detaching the wiper restored communication quickly. The fix was a brand-new motor, but the key was recognizing that one inexpensive part might silence the network.
The EVAP system is a frequent trigger for check engine lights that bring a mobile mechanic to a driveway. Small leakage codes can be irritating without a smoke maker. Introduce smoke at the service port, close the purge valve by means of the scan tool, and look for wisps at the filler neck, the vent valve, or the top of the tank. On older trucks, the vent valve near the spare tire decomposes. On compact cars and trucks, the O-ring on the fuel pump module under the rear seat dries and cracks. You can see faint tendrils emerge, in some cases just when you tap the body or flex the lines.
It is crucial to check with the system sealed as the automobile controls it. If the purge valve bleeds, the smoke will go to the consumption and puzzle the result. Control the valves with the scan tool or utilize hose pinch pliers sensibly. Document the leak source with a quick image for the customer; it constructs trust and assists if a part should be ordered.
Intermittents are where on-site diagnostics earns regard. The sign vanishes as you get here. You can not force a misfire that only appears after a 20-minute heat soak, but you can instrument for it. A compact Bluetooth information logger paired with the scan tool can capture criteria while the customer drives. Set triggers for occasions: fuel trims above a threshold, cam-crank connection errors, or misfire counts increasing on a specific cylinder. Ask the chauffeur to keep in mind the exact time when the sign happens, then match it to the trace.
Heat-related failures betray themselves when the hood is closed and the vehicle sits. A crankshaft position sensing unit that fails hot might pass a static resistance test but show a dropout on a scope when warmed with a heat gun. Ignition coils with internal fractures typically arc when humidity spikes. If the schedule permits, you suffer the heat soak and replicate the failure on-site. If not, you establish a tracking plan and a follow-up see, instead of gambling on parts.
Servicing hybrids and electric cars on-site is possible, however just within rigorous security borders. A mobile mechanic trained for high voltage carries insulated gloves rated and tested, an insulated mat, lockout tags, and knows the place of service disconnects. Diagnostics typically begin low voltage: a weak 12-volt battery can waterfall faults throughout a hybrid system that appears much more serious than it is. I have actually restored a "hybrid system failure" message with nothing more than a brand-new 12-volt AGM battery and a correct relearn.
When high-voltage faults are genuine, such as seclusion faults or inverter temperature level warnings, the mobile visit may identify seriousness and then move the cars and truck to a controlled environment. On-site scope work on resolver signals and inverter commands is possible, however any direct exposure of orange cables or battery packs is a stop point unless the conditions are safe.
Many contemporary repairs consist of code. After changing a throttle body, you may require an idle air volume relearn. After a battery swap on high-end brands, you need to register battery type and capacity. Some misfire concerns deal with just after a PCM upgrade that changes injector timing or knock control. A ready mobile mechanic maintains memberships for OEM service details and uses a pass-thru gadget when the task necessitates it. That stated, not every parking area is the ideal place for a firmware update. A flaky Wi-Fi signal or a weak battery charger can brick a module. The judgment call belongs to the craft: perform relearns and adaptations on-site, however schedule complicated programming with steady power and network.

A compact hatchback with a rough idle and a stable MIL: The scan tool revealed P0171 lean bank one, STFT hovering at +18 percent at idle, dropping to near zero at 2,500 rpm. MAF read low at idle but tracked engine speed. Smoke at the consumption revealed a hairline fracture in the PCV tube concealed under a foam sleeve. Replacing the tube and cleaning trims fixed the concern. The client had changed the MAF and plugs before calling, which just annoyed them. A 15-minute smoke test conserved them another round of guesswork.
A crossover with periodic no-crank after refueling: The battery and starter tested fine. Freeze frame for a P0455 large EVAP leak revealed it set whenever after a fill-up. Viewing live information during a stall occasion revealed the PCM commanding start but seeing a void signal from the variety selector. The real perpetrator was an inflamed adapter at the EVAP vent valve near the back, which shorted when filled with fuel vapor after completing. Changing the vent valve and pigtail, plus advising the motorist to stop at the first click, ended both the EVAP codes and the no-crank. The short had actually taken down a shared referral line that confused the variety sensor. One symptom hid another; only a holistic read put it together.

Most drivelines, ignition problems, sensing unit faults, and charging issues can be recognized and often fixed on-site. Consumption leaks, coolant pipe failures, belt tensioner replacements, and lots of brake issues are straightforward with portable gear. Deep engine work, internal transmission faults, large cooling system overhauls, and structural electrical harness repairs belong in a bay with a lift and full safety equipment.
The seasoned mobile mechanic understands where to draw that line. Stating no to a limited roadside timing belt job is not timidity, it is judgment. The objective is to return the vehicle to service dependably, not to win a dare.
